Job description

As our Carpenter, you will play a key role in building high‑quality and safe construction projects by demonstrating strong craftsmanship, attention to detail, and effective coordination with project teams. You will perform a variety of carpentry tasks including framing, formwork, installation of building components, and finish work. You will also help ensure that all work aligns with project plans, specifications, and quality standards while ensuring a safe, hazard free work environment.

Experienced carpenters may take on more complex scopes of work, lead small crews, oversee installation quality, and support continuous improvement in field execution. Successful carpenters in this role are committed to safety, workmanship, teamwork, and delivering excellent results in a fast‑paced construction environment.
